Output 3ebbda5dc506366bbdc2196c3db3360abfe7f7aa85a5ec63aed5a73ff98e1f98:0

value
13303000
script pubkey
OP_0 OP_PUSHBYTES_20 8d121de851aee1ed25ea1750196bf92fa400d60a
address
bc1q35fpm6z34ms76f02zagpj6le97jqp4s285ktp6
transaction
3ebbda5dc506366bbdc2196c3db3360abfe7f7aa85a5ec63aed5a73ff98e1f98
confirmations
56610
spent
true